Kimmis Skrevet Oktober 25, 2010 Rapporter Share Skrevet Oktober 25, 2010 1) Turn on radio and the radio display shows "SAFE", thus the problem. 2) Press the P.Scan and RBDS buttons simultaneously (at the same time) and hold until "1000" is displayed. Release the buttons but Do NOT press buttons again as the radio will think the "1000" is the code. 3) Use Preset buttons 1 through 4 to enter the four-digit code number from your radio card that you got when you bought the car. Preset button 1 corresponds to the first digit, preset button 2 corresponds to the second digit, and so on and so on. 4) Once the code shown on the display is correct you must press the P.Scan and RBDS buttons simultaneously and hold until the word "SAFE" appears in the display again. Once the word "SAFE" appears you can release the buttons. 4) The radio should unlock and be available shortly afterwards. 5) If an incorrect code is entered, the word "SAFE" appears, first flashing and then continuously. You can repeat the above steps to unlock the radio once more, the number of attempts will be shown in the display. If an incorrect code is entered again, you radio will be locked for about one hour. After one hour - the radio must stay on and the key must remain in the ignition lock - if the display goes out, the you can repeat the above procedure to unlock again. The cycle - two attempts, one hour lock-up - still applies. 6) If you lose your radio code, contact your Audi dealer as you are SOL. http://www.ibiblio.org/tkan/audi/radios/symphony.html Siter Lenke til kommentar Del på andre sider More sharing options...
